DETA Hedman booked her place in the quarter-finals of the BDO World Darts Championship after a comfortable victory on Saturday night.
The Oxfordshire county player and three-time finalist beat Rachna David 2-0 at the Lakeside Country Club.
The victory ensured there was to be no repeat of her shock first-round exit 12 months ago when she lost to Casey Gallagher.
The 58-year-old, ranked world No 1, is still searching for her first world title after being denied in three finals, but proved a class above her rival.
Hedman will next face eighth seed Sharon Prins, who beat Maria O'Brien 2-0, in the quarter-finals on Thursday.
